Public Wi-Fi networks have always been risky, but in 2025 the threat level has multiplied dramatically. Hackers now deploy autonomous bots that scan every device connected to open networks looking for vulnerabilities, misconfigurations, exposed ports, and unencrypted transfers. Airports and crowded areas are especially risky because attackers blend seamlessly within the environment. Once inside, they can clone legitimate Wi-Fi names—like 'Airport_Free_WiFi'—and trick users into connecting. Public Wi-Fi threats have evolved far beyond traditional password sniffing. In 2025, tools like AI-driven packet analyzers and automated exploit frameworks allow attackers to execute complex attacks within seconds. These tools can detect device OS versions, unpatched software, browser vulnerabilities, and vulnerable apps. They then deploy targeted attacks automatically, requiring zero human interaction. Even when you avoid logging in to important accounts, many apps maintain persistent sessions with authentication cookies. Attackers use sidejacking tools to capture these tokens and impersonate your sessions instantly. Social media, banking previews, cloud drives, and even game platforms are vulnerable. Rogue DNS servers have also become a huge issue. Hackers manipulate DNS responses on public networks to redirect users to fake versions of real websites—banking sites, shopping portals, login pages—without detection. This attack is known as pharming, and it has become increasingly automated. A VPN bypasses local DNS manipulation by routing DNS queries through secure, private DNS servers.
